#180062 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#180062 is composed of 9.4% red, 0% green and 38.4%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 75.5% cyan, 100% magenta, 0% yellow and 61.6% black. It has a hue angle of 254.7 degrees, a saturation of 100% and a lightness of 19.2%. #180062 color hex could be obtained by blending #3000c4 with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#000066.

#180062 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#180062 has RGB values of R:24, G:0, B:98 and CMYK values of C:0.76, M:1, Y:0, K:0.62. Its decimal value is 1572962.
